'''Active Probes''' contain an active element like a FET or a tube right at the tip of the probe to create higher input impedances and eliminate cable loading, most useful for high frequency probing.

===Notes===
===Notes===
''[note 1]'' These probes are active probes only for DC. For AC these probes are regular 50 Ω passive probes. For DC the load impedance is virtually connected to the offset voltage by means of an operational amplifier, so the DC loading can be tuned out for signals offset from 0V. They are listed here for completeness since Tektronix lists them as such in the [http://w140.com/tekp6203-p62204-p62205-p6217-p6231.pdf Tektronix P6203 P6204 P6205 P6217 P6231 Catalog Specs (PDF)].
